1樓:樹懶學堂
count() 函式返回匹配指定條件的行數。
sql count(column_name) 語法
count(column_name) 函式返回指定列的值的數目(null 不計入):
sql count(*) 語法
count(*) 函式返回表中的記錄數:
sql count(distinct column_name) 語法
count(distinct column_name) 函式返回指定列的不同值的數目:
註釋:count(distinct) 適用於 oracle 和 microsoft sql server,但是無法用於 microsoft access。
-from shulanxt
整理不易,望採納~
2樓:公冶菡
把select查詢語句中的列選擇部分換成count(*)或者count(列名)。那麼查詢語句就會返回select查詢結果的資料有多少條。也就是帶有count的查詢,其返回結果就是一行一列的一個數字。
例如:select * from student where name like '張%'; //查詢所有姓張的學生資訊
select count(*) from student where name like '張%' //查詢姓張的學生的人數
而count(列名)在統計結果的時候,會忽略列值為空(這裡的空不是隻空字串或者0,而是表示null)的計數。
select count(en_score) from student where name like '張%' //查詢姓張的學生中有英語成績的學生人數
SQL count是什麼意思,sql中count是什麼含義
select card1 from merge.train where isfraud 1 效果 card1 select card1,count as counts from merge.train where isfraud 1 group by card1 效果 card1 counts 10...
sql中exists是什麼意思,怎麼講解
sql exists exists 運算子用於判斷查詢子句是否有記錄,如果有一條或多條記錄存在返回 true,否則返回 false。具體語法參考 from 樹懶學堂 sql exists 例項現在我們想要查詢總訪問量 count 欄位 大於 200 的 是否存在。我們使用下面的 sql 語句 exi...
matlab中zeros函式是什麼含義
大野瘦子 zeros 1,8 意思就是一個一行8列的零矩陣。因為zeros 8 相當於是zeros 8,8 的簡寫形式,括號裡面的數字,一個是表示多少行,一個是表示多少列。zeros功能是返回一個m n p 的double類零矩陣的一個函式。注意 m,n,p,必須是非負整數,負整數將被當做0看待。z...